Spatiotemporal dynamics in airborne fungi and fungal allergens across the United States

2025-12-23

Abstract excerpt

<h4>ABSTRACT</h4> A broad diversity of fungi can be found in the near-surface atmosphere, with both the amounts and types of airborne fungi varying across space and time. However, the specific spatiotemporal patterns in airborne fungal assemblages often remain unquantified. This knowledge gap is particularly notable for allergenic fungi, despite the relevance of airborne fungal allergen exposures to public health...
